DID Digit Conversion Table
& DNIS Assignment
General Description
Up to 200 incoming DID numbers can be assigned individually to ring at preassigned extension
numbers on a day mode and night mode basis. This Memory Block applies to the DID number
after it is modified by Memory Block 5-00.

Programming Procedures
1
Go off-line.
2
Press LK1 + LK1 + BB to access the Memory Block.
3
Enter the data using the dial pad.
Note: Use the following to enter data:
J to move the cursor left
L to move the cursor right
K~I to enter numeric data
S to change DNIS, then use K~I to enter an alphanumeric name for
each indial number (name applies to both day and night mode). Refer to
Table 1,
“System Data Input,” on page 541
for details on character entry.
Q to change between Day and Night table
U to clear all data
Default Values
Not Assigned.
Setting Data
TEL = LK1 = Extension No.
00~99
000~999
0000~9999
TENANT = LK2 = 00~47
4
PressNto write the data.
5
PressPto go back on-line.
